Multiline Representative – Service Focused with In-Book Sales Opportunity Jim Rottkamp State Farm 23 Old Kings Hwy Darien, CT 06820-3611 Full-Time | In-Office (Hybrid Eligible After Training)
Deliver Exceptional Service. Build Relationships. Support Growth.
Jim Rottkamp State Farm is seeking a highly service-driven Multiline Representative who enjoys helping people, building strong relationships, and delivering a high-quality customer experience. This role is ideal for someone who leads with empathy and can confidently identify opportunities to strengthen coverage through in-book sales when it benefits the customer.
If you are customer-focused, organized, and interested in growing within the insurance industry, this is a great opportunity to build a long-term career in a supportive and team-oriented environment.
Work Environment
• In-office during training and onboarding • Hybrid opportunity available after training (up to 2 days per week remote)
Licensing Requirement (Job Contingent)
This position is contingent upon obtaining required insurance licenses.
• Property & Casualty license must be obtained prior to your Day 1 start (full support provided) • We provide guidance, resources, and support to help you successfully complete the licensing process
Role Overview
As a Multiline Representative, you will support both customer service and relationship management, ensuring a seamless experience for new and existing customers. This role is primarily service-focused, with the opportunity to contribute to growth by identifying additional coverage needs through thoughtful, needs-based conversations.
Success in this role is measured by customer satisfaction, retention, and contribution to agency growth.
Responsibilities
Communicate with customers to understand their needs and provide accurate product and policy information
Assist with policy changes, updates, endorsements, and billing questions
Build and maintain strong relationships with new and existing customers
Support daily office operations including documentation, scheduling, and follow-up
Participate in marketing and outreach efforts to support agency visibility
Identify opportunities to enhance coverage and pivot service conversations into in-book sales
Maintain accurate and detailed records of customer interactions
Collaborate with team members to deliver a consistent, high-quality customer experience
Ensure compliance with agency standards and applicable regulations
Qualifications
Strong customer service and relationship-building skills
Effective written and verbal communication abilities
Detail-oriented with strong organizational and multitasking skills
Problem-solving mindset with a focus on customer experience
Comfortable discussing coverage options and recommending solutions when appropriate
Prior customer service, business support, or insurance experience preferred
Ability to meet licensing requirements outlined above
What We Offer
Competitive base salary plus performance-based incentives
Full support through the licensing process
Ongoing training and professional development
A collaborative, service-focused team environment
Hybrid work flexibility after training
Opportunities for long-term growth within the agency
